Launch Week Turns Into a Live Growth Test

The week around playnance’s coin turns launch has become a real-time growth test for a market hungry for tangible tokenomics in gaming. In the days leading up to the March 18 token generation event, observers watched a flurry of activity that suggested the token would not merely rise or fall on sentiment, but on actual platform usage and developer adoption.

G Coin is positioned as the utility layer for gameplay, rewards, partner revenue distribution, and treasury flows, all built atop PlayBlock. The project touts gasless execution, deterministic settlement, and sub-second finality as core advantages that could translate into quicker, cheaper interactions for players and studios alike. This backdrop matters because the token debut was less about pricing a new asset and more about pricing activity that Playnance claims already exists across gaming, prediction markets, and other entertainment experiences.

Live Data From Launch Week

  • Pre-launch traction: Public trackers estimated more than 200,000 holders and a market capitalization near $38 million before the March 18 token generation event.
  • Existing ecosystem scale: The broader PlayBlock network reportedly supported 10,000+ on-chain games, integrated with more than 30 game studios, and handling roughly 2 million on-chain transactions each day.
  • Staking as the first growth signal: On March 16, staking for GCOIN launched on PlayW3. Early media notes pegged the amount of locked tokens in the hundreds of millions within hours, signaling intense demand to participate in the ecosystem.
  • Escalation post-launch: By March 18, coverage from major outlets reported the staking total surpassing the 1 billion mark within hours of the market debut, underscoring a capture of liquidity by active participants.

Market observers framed the staking spike as a proof point that the ecosystem was not just releasing a token but inviting immediate, usable activity. Analysts cited the combination of a large existing user base, widespread game integrations, and a staking model that rewards activity rather than inflation as factors behind the rapid uptake.

What This Means for Playnance and Crypto Gaming

The sustained staking momentum has become the clearest signal of how investors respond to token economics that align incentives with platform usage. Playnance describes GCOIN as a fuel for gameplay mechanics, rewards distribution, partner revenue sharing, and treasury operations—intended to flow through PlayBlock in a way that incentivizes ongoing participation rather than short-term buy-and-hold gambits.

A Playnance spokesperson offered a concise takeaway on the architecture: “Our staking design ties rewards to ecosystem activity, not fixed inflation.” The quote captures the philosophy of a model centered on utility and active engagement, which could influence how the market values the token as an instrument of gameplay rather than a simple speculative asset.

Industry analysts note that the real test will come from sustained activity across games and studios, not just a spike around launch week. If the pacing holds—meaning the number of daily transactions and the volume of in-game rewards remain robust—the market could see a more stable trend in the token’s liquidity and demand for longer lockups.

Crypto market watcher Maya Chen from TokenPulse Research said: “playnance’s coin turns launch has created a live case study in how token economics can be tuned to actual user behavior. The question is whether this demand holds as volatility seeps in and as the broader market environment shifts.” Her assessment highlights the structural risks around token prices driven by behavior rather than purely by news cycles or macro shifts.

Market Context and Potential Risks

The launch arrives as the broader crypto sector faces a mixed tape of regulatory scrutiny, traditional tech funding dynamics, and evolving consumer interest in play-to-earn and play-to-win frameworks. For Playnance, the immediate takeaway is whether the GCOIN staking dynamic creates a stable long-term liquidity base. If the model continues to reward real in-game activity, early holders could benefit from reduced circulating supply and a more resilient price floor as demand remains tied to platform use.

Yet risks remain. A token tied to on-chain activity can be sensitive to shifts in game partnerships, changes to the PlayBlock platform, or broader regulatory changes that alter how tokenized ecosystems are monetized. Traders will be watching how staking unlocks are managed, whether liquidity remains tight, and how the ecosystem scales beyond the initial game studios already integrated into the network.
